CBI reported sales, at the end of the weekly auction on Thursday, a slight decrease to sell $ 106 million after it sold $ 107 million yesterday.
According to a statement of the bank, the agency received all of Iraq [where] a copy of "The size of the amount sold today reached 106 million, 782 thousand and $ 96, priced at 1182 dinars exchange rate against the dollar, and with the participation of 30 banks and 23 financial transfer company."
He pointed out that "the amount of remittances and credits amounted to 93 million and 297 thousand and $ 96, in what was the quantity sold in cash and 13 million 485 thousand dollars."
The statement pointed out that "the amounts transferred to the accounts of banks selling abroad is priced at 1190 dinars per dollar, and the cash sales price shall be the price of 1182 dinars per dollar."
The statistics of the Central Bank of Iraq reported the sale of the bank about $ 9 billion in the auction for the sale of foreign currency since the beginning of this year 2016 and up to 15 of this April.
